私は2つの異なるテーブルがあります。tbl_records、tbl_users複数のフィルタに一致するテーブルからデータをフェッチする方法は?
私はF_NAME =「のKr」で公開され、今日(レコードの日付)に挿入されるtbl_records、すべてのデータを取得したいが。
私は2つの異なるテーブルがあります。tbl_records、tbl_users複数のフィルタに一致するテーブルからデータをフェッチする方法は?
私はF_NAME =「のKr」で公開され、今日(レコードの日付)に挿入されるtbl_records、すべてのデータを取得したいが。
、これを試してみてくださいこれは、後に深夜より上date_of_recordまたは今日で、F_NAMEを持つユーザーのKr 'のtbl_recordsからすべての列を返します。
SELECT r.* FROM tbl_records r
INNER JOIN tbl_users u ON r.user_id = u.user_id
WHERE r.date_of_record >= DATE(NOW()) AND u.f_name LIKE 'Kr'
それはあなたが望む正確な列を指定する方が良いでしょうけれども、ケース内のテーブル定義は後で変更されています
SELECT r.user_id, r.status, r.date_of_record FROM tbl_records r
INNER JOIN tbl_users u ON r.user_id = u.user_id
WHERE r.date_of_record >= DATE(NOW()) AND u.f_name LIKE 'Kr'
SELECT * FROM tbl_records AS tr JOIN tbl_users AS tu ON (tr.user_id = tu.user_id) AND tr.date_of_record = DATE(NOW()) AND tu.f_name = 'kr'
あなたが答えたので、質問した画像が更新されているように見えます。 – raveturned
あなたは正しく編集しています。ご意見ありがとうございます。 –